Haar classifier download free

Dose anyone have haar cascade classifier xml file for hand. Detecting cars in a video using opencv and haar cascades. In the violajones object detection framework, the haarlike features are therefore organized in something called a classifier cascade to form a strong learner or classifier. You dont need to go to other websites to find the cascade classifier files. Haar classifier tutorial note we have since realized that cvcreateimage allocated memory on the heap, not the stack. Pull requests will be merged of course, and if someone else wants commit access, feel free to ask. Haar cascade classifiers and the lbpbased classifiers used to be the best tools for object detection.

Cascade trainer gui is a program that can be used to train, test and improve. Youll receive a number of folders, each with a different purpose. Multiview face detection and recognition using haarlike features zhaomin zhu, takashi morimoto, hidekazu adachi, osamu kiriyama, tetsushi koide and hans juergen mattausch research center for nanodevices and systems, hiroshima university email. Nov 20, 2018 in this video we detect cars using opencv and haar cascade using pretrained haar cascade classifier. It detects facial features and ignores anything else, such as buildings, trees and bodies. Gender classifier with tensorflow and opencv the startup. Music classifier freeware free download music classifier. Welcome to an object detection tutorial with opencv and python. Face detection is a computer technology that determines the locations and sizes of human faces in arbitrary digital images. Face detection can be regarded as a more general case of face localization. Rdp classifier the rdp classifier is a naive bayesian classifier that can rapidly and accurately provides taxonomic. Questions tagged haar classifier ask question visual neural network recognizer that breaks up an image into digital image features nose, mouth, etc to improve accuracy in object recognition. Face detection uses classifiers, which are algorithms that detects what is either a face1 or not a face0 in an image.

November 25, 2017 haar cascade training on windows by gui tool, vision 1. Due to the nature and complexity of this task, this tutorial will be a bit longer than usual, but the reward is massive. Haar classifier tutorial learning opencv with xcode. Aug 07, 2011 how to do opencv haar training opencv is an image processing library made by intel. Object detection using haar featurebased cascade classifiers is an effective object detection method proposed by paul viola and michael jones in their paper, rapid object detection using a boosted cascade of simple features in 2001. Make your own haar cascade object detector on windows.

A vehicle counter program based on traffic video feed for specific type of vehicle using haar cascade classifier was made as the output of this research. Jan 28, 2019 the haar classifier based detection method is considered to be much more robust when we have a very good trained classifier, which is based on prerecognized hand gestures. In this tutorial, you will be shown how to create your very own haar cascades, so you can track any object you want. For this, haar features shown in the below image are used. Multiview face detection and recognition using haar like. Since i no longer work with opencv, and dont have the time to keep up with changes and fixes, this guide is unmaintained. How does haar cascade classifier algorytm work essay. You dont need to go to other websites to find the cascade classifier.

I have downloaded the xml file to my local and used the path of my machine, but you could directly point it to the github location if you want. Object detection using haar featurebased cascade classifiers is an effective object detection method proposed by paul viola and michael jones in their paper. Evaluation of haar cascade classifiers for face detection. Object detection using custom haar cascade on an image with opencv runcustomcascade. Introduction there are a number of techniques that can successfully. Inside youll find my handpicked tutorials, books, courses, and libraries to help you master cv and dl.

Python haar cascades for object detection geeksforgeeks. Contribute to opencvopencv development by creating an account on github. Computer vision detecting objects using haar cascade classifier. It provides many useful high performance algorithms for image processing such as. Make sure you have python, matplotlib and opencv installed on your pc all the latest versions. Does anyone know of a downloadable large faces dataset. The key advantage of a haarlike feature over most other features is its calculation speed.

The hassle free method of creating your own haar cascade is here. Jan 03, 2018 a complete collection of haar cascade files. Initially, the algorithm needs a lot of positive images images of faces and negative images images without faces to train the classifier. It is an opensource library and it can be used for many image processing projects haar training is a set of procedures for doing detections like face,eye etc. I searched for finding xml file of haar cascade classifier, but there there wasnt an appropriate. Face detection using opencv with haar cascade classifiers. Face detection classifiers are shared by public communities, such as opencv.

So this is a great advantage for the haar classifier method, but it can also backfire, if the cascade is not well trained with enough positive samples. Apr 20, 2019 the haar cascade we will use for our purpose is the frontal face default cascade which you can download directly from the opencv github repository. Training and applying the haar cascade classifier to detect cats and dogs faces. Haar cascade training on windows by gui tool jackyle 2018. It is a machine learning based approach where a cascade function is trained from a lot of positive and. The first step towards making a haar classifier is collecting images for training. Face and eye detection from images using haar cascade classifier.

Resolution videos using fastest available cascade classifier and core patterns. An evaluation of these classifiers will help researchers to choose the best classifier for their particular need. Jan 23, 2017 training a better haar and lbp cascade based eye detector using opencv. Classifiers have been trained to detect faces using thousands to millions of images in order to get more accuracy. Newest haar classifier questions feed to subscribe to this rss feed, copy and paste this url into your rss reader. Cascade classifier for face detection huachun yang, xu an. Pdf vehicle classification using haar cascade classifier. When computer vision met convolutional neural networks, cascade classifiers. Sep 30, 2016 make your own haar cascade object detector on windows quick and very easy duration. Jun 20, 2016 get your free 17 page computer vision, opencv, and deep learning resource guide pdf.

It can be for any objects as long as its a properly working cascade. Face detection using haar cascades opencvpython tutorials 1. Haar like features are digital image features used in object recognition. It uses a graphical interface to set the parameters and make it easy to use opencv tools for training and testing classifiers. Newest haarclassifier questions page 3 stack overflow. Object detection using custom haar cascade on an image. Ares music is a free peer to peer file sharing program that allows users to share any digital file including pictures, mp3s, videos, software programs, etc. Apr 24, 2017 train your own opencv haar classifier. Haar cascade training on windows by gui tool youtube. Make your own haar cascade object detector on windows quick and very easy duration. Get a comparison of convolutional neural networks and cascade classifiers for object detection by learning about research on object detection of license plates. Opencv uses two types of classifiers, lbp local binary pattern and haar cascades. Cascade trainer gui is a program that can be used to train, test and improve cascade classifier models. Dose anyone have haar cascade classifier xml file for hand gestures.

878 455 729 1120 1236 745 532 256 1527 1428 852 1220 725 940 1401 789 155 837 647 1351 357 689 782 1061 940 1306 133 1542 334 915 691 836 945 941 505 1004 851 570 769 660 1459 146 510